Summary

US Foods, Inc. has announced plans to cut 114 jobs at one of its U.S. facilities, with layoffs scheduled for 2026. This decision comes as part of a broader strategy to streamline operations and reduce costs. The specific reasons for the job cuts were not detailed in the announcement, but the company is likely responding to market pressures. The layoffs will affect various roles within the facility, impacting the workforce significantly. Further details regarding the exact timing and departments affected are expected to be released as the date approaches.

US Foods, Inc. cut 114 jobs as of January 1, 2026.

That is roughly 0.5% of the 25,000 people US Foods, Inc. employs.

LayoffTalk has tracked 9 layoff events at US Foods, Inc. since September 2024, including 263 jobs documented in official WARN filings, with 6 additional events known from news reporting.
